Ladies and gentlemen. This fight is 3 rounds, in the welterweight division.
Introducing the fighter to my left, fighting out of the red corner.
With a record of 0 - 0 - 0, fighting out of Las Vegas, Jeremiah Hobbs!
And introducing the fighter to my right, fighting out of the blue corner.
With a record of 0 - 0 - 0, fighting out of Amsterdam, Amadeus Macer!
The judges for this bout are Wesley Smith, Chris Downing and Daniel Franklin.




The bell rings for round one and we are underway!
Macer comes forward and lands a shot to the body, then darts back out of range.
Macer uses good head movement to avoid the hook from Hobbs.
Macer lands with a shot to the body.

Hobbs drives through with a really nice takedown into side control.
Macer sneaks back into half guard.
The fighters are pressed up against the cage, both looking to find a bit of space to work.
Macer regains full guard, whilst avoiding punches from Hobbs.
Macer avoiding any damage from the ground and pound.
Macer seems keen to control rather than go for a submission, at least for now.
Hobbs working some ground and pound from guard but it's not doing any damage.
Hobbs postures up to throw the ground and pound strikes but they don't connect.
Hobbs stands up over Macer, holding his feet. He dives back in and lands a decent shot to the head.

That's one minute gone in the round.
Hobbs missing there with some ground and pound from the guard.
Macer is pulling down on Hobbs's head to control his posture.
Hobbs throws a big right hand that misses.
Hobbs is looking to work some ground and pound but Macer has wrist control.
Macer has momentary wrist control but Hobbs slips an elbow through the middle.
Macer wants to sweep here but Hobbs controlling him for the moment.
A big thud reverberates around the arena there as Hobbs accidentally thumps the mat. Hopefully he's not broken his hand.
Macer is working an open guard here, looking to improve his position. No doubt that will leave him open to counters but at least he's being more offensive.
Hobbs throws an elbow that misses. Macer uses the momentum to reverse the position. He's now in Hobbs's guard. Nice move by Macer!


That's two minutes gone in the round.
Macer stopping the sweep attempt from Hobbs.
Macer sitting in guard here, content to control.
Let's hope that Macer has the urge to step up the pace any second now because for the last 15 or 20 seconds he's just been holding on tight.
The ref warns both fighters not to hold the cage as they work up against the meshing.
Hobbs wants to control the position but Macer says "no thanks buddy" and passes to half guard.
Hobbs on his back here. We all know that wrestlers don't like being on their back so let's see if Hobbs tries to get out of the position.
Hobbs is looking to regain full guard. Not this time though.
Hobbs punching from the bottom.
Hobbs wants to get back to full guard but Macer has passed into side control.

Macer stands up and we're back to a striking position.

That's three minutes gone in the round.
Macer connects with a nice looking jab.

Hobbs feints and as Macer raises his hands in defense, Hobbs changes levels and drives through with a takedown into guard.
Macer bucks up whilst keeping hold of a body lock, managing to reverse the position. Now he's in top in Hobbs's guard.

Hobbs throwing some rather feeble looking strikes off his back.
Macer slows down the pace of the fight, as he sits in guard.
Hobbs working a defensive guard but Macer passes into half guard.
Macer looks over to his corner - he wants some instructions but his corner are not responding.
Macer passes the guard and advances to mount!

That's four minutes gone in the round.
Macer controlling from the full mount.
We're seeing a lot of stalling here from Macer.
Macer is continuing to stall.
Hobbs swinging wildly from the bottom but he's not landing.
The crowd thankful this round is nearly over.
Macer tucks in and makes sure he doesn't lose the dominant position.
And that is the end of the round. The fighters go back to their corners.

Amadeus Macer dominated that round.
That's time! Back to the action!


Hobbs closes the distance and looks for a trip takedown... aaaand he's got it - Hobbs lands in his opponent's guard.

Macer wriggles free and stands up.
Hobbs looks for a takedown but Macer sprawls well.
Macer now looks to counter with a shot at the body.
Macer has been the more effective fighter overall so far.
Hobbs with a lazy takedown attempt
and Macer counters with a quick right hand to the jaw.
Hobbs moves forwards but Macer connects with a nice, crisp jab.
Hobbs gets caught by a big overhand right and goes down! Macer gets on top of him and starts throwing some serious punches until the ref intervenes and stops the fight!

Ladies and gentlemen, after 0:42 of round 2, we have a winner by way of TKO (Strikes). Amadeus Macer!
Amadeus Macer seemed lost for words in his post fight interview but he remembered to thank his fans and directed everyone to his website.
